Lags officially puts an end to the torturous year long hiatus without any new music releases as he presents his signature musical style and complex songwriting once again in 'Pansamantala'.

The track transcends beyond being just another song, it takes the form of a quiet confession of the pain and longing that comes with loving someone wholeheartedly while they stay bonded to the shackles of their past. Their choice to stay behind in memories of others instead of choosing to move on and make new memories causes a painful sting that is depicted in each lyric of 'Pansamantala'.

Each word adds a layer to the emotions and story from the opening plea “Look into my eyes, don’t you see me” to the crushing revelation of being “replaced by the past,” the song flows like an quiet conversation, resonating with many listeners.

The inspiration for the song sparked after Lags had a heart to heart conversation with a friend about the importance of closure, which caused the realisation that he was never chosen in the fight between someone's past and a chance for him to be someone's present and future. The dreaded question, "What will happen to me?” becomes the underlying focus of the track that tells a story of heartbreak and betrayal.

'Pansamantala' marks Lags’ heartfelt return, capturing the complexities of modern love and proving the timeless impact of sincere OPM ballads. The track lingers long after the final note, its raw emotion and intricate storytelling capturing the universal ache of unrequited love and the struggle to find closure.
